Symphony No. 17 In G Major, K. 129 III. Finale composed by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art. 1756-1791. Arranged by Sandra Dackow. For String Orchestra. Grade 3. Set of parts. Published by Tempo Press. TM.10250112. This symphony was written in Salzburg, in May of 1772, when the composer was sixteen, during a year of incredible maturing as a symphonist. Eight symphonies followed one another within less than a year, showing the influence of a recent visit to Italy. This sunny finale, with its flavor of the hunt, offers a good example of the young composer's work at a time when he was rapidly absorbing the influence of various national styles.
